ALDERBURY FC Under 15s' girls had another fine win on Saturday, thumping Hedge End 9-1.
That's 10 wins from the last 10 games, scoring 71 goals and conceding just seven.
This means Alderbury now sit second, three points behind Merley Cobham but with two games in hand.
Their reward for this excellent run comes this Saturday with a cup semi-final against Portsmouth Ladies Under 15s.
Elsewhere, Alderbury Under 12s beat Simply Soccer 10-0 in the semi-final of the cup to set-up a final tie with Salisbury.
